In today's rapidly evolving digital landscape, governments, donor agencies, non-governmental organizations, humanitarian institutions, healthcare organizations, research institutions, and private sector entities generate massive volumes of data through monitoring and evaluation systems, surveys, administrative databases, mobile technologies, social media platforms, and management information systems. Predictive analytics provides organizations with the ability to transform historical and real-time data into actionable insights that support strategic planning, performance management, risk mitigation, and sustainable development outcomes.
Modern development programs operate in complex environments characterized by uncertainty, dynamic stakeholder needs, and rapidly changing socioeconomic conditions. Traditional monitoring systems often focus on historical reporting and descriptive analysis, limiting organizational capacity to anticipate future challenges and opportunities. Predictive analytics addresses these limitations by utilizing statistical models, machine learning techniques, forecasting methodologies, and advanced analytical algorithms to predict trends, identify patterns, estimate future outcomes, and support proactive interventions. Effective application of predictive analytics strengthens monitoring and evaluation systems, enhances organizational learning, improves resource allocation, and enables evidence-based decision-making that maximizes development impact and operational efficiency.
